    Re: Good Gaming Monitor.

    I have 24" VW246H monitor which looks to be same but as compare it is slightly smaller screen in space.

    I don't have any negative impact as related to height adjustment is concern but it seems to be good enough if it is kept to our eye level.

    It is good for the pace gaming and it works smoothly. It has a very good and bright screen. In fact i do not have any problem with my monitor and i was lucky to get in perfect condition with no dead pixels on it. It works smoothly for a sub $250 LCD. The unit is very stable and in fact it does not have much weight in it. It contains DVI, VGA, and HDMI inputs in it which seems to look nice. It also allows you to hook up the PS3 or 360 or BR player.
